Abstract

The metabolism of furaltadone was examined by an in vitro hepatic study in cows and goats and an in vivo study in goats using 14C-labeled and unlabeled drug. The half-life of furaltadone was 13min in the homogenates of caprine and bovine liver and 35min in the in vivo study of the goat. Less than 2% of the parent drug was present in the urine of animals dosed either intravenously or intramammarily. No furaltadone was detected in the milk after 24h. Overall, the parent compound was rapidly absorbed, distributed, and widely degraded in the lactacting goat. The compound, labeled at the 2-formyl carbon of the furan ring, had a radioactivity recovery of 81% in the feces and urine. Of the total radioactivity, 99.4% infused into the udder had been absorbed after 72h. Tissue distributions of radioactivity in decreasing order of abundance were: kidney, udder, liver, duodenum, muscular tissue, adipose tissue, and bile.
